About Oil, Gas & Energy Law in Antwerp, Belgium
The city of Antwerp, located in the Flemish region of Belgium, is a significant hub for the oil, gas, and energy sector. Its strategic position along the River Scheldt, extensive port facilities, and proximity to other major European cities make it an integral node for the transshipment of energy products. Antwerp's energy sector encompasses a wide range of activities, including oil refining, natural gas distribution, renewable energies, and petrochemical manufacturing. Legal frameworks guiding these activities are multifaceted and involve regional, national, and European Union regulations aimed at ensuring safe, efficient, and environmentally responsible practices across the sector.

Local Laws Overview
Belgium's legal landscape for oil, gas, and energy is governed by several key pieces of legislation and regulatory bodies:
- Environmental Regulations: Belgium implements strict environmental standards, particularly those stemming from EU legislation, to control pollution and guarantee sustainable energy practices.
- Energy Market Regulations: The Belgian energy market is regulated to ensure fair competition and security of supply, guided by both national provisions and the EU's internal market principles.
- Renewable Energy Incentives: The government offers various incentives and subsidies for renewable energy projects, pushing towards a greener energy transition.
- Licensing and Permit Requirements: Companies are required to obtain various permits and licenses to explore, produce, distribute, or retail energy resources.
- Taxation: Unique tax considerations apply to oil and gas operations, influenced by both federal tax policy and European directives.
Frequently Asked Questions
What permits are required to start an oil and gas business in Antwerp?
Starting an oil and gas business in Antwerp requires a series of permits and licenses including environmental permits, construction permits, and operational licenses specific to energy activities.
Are there specific environmental regulations I should be aware of?
Yes, there are strict environmental regulations enforced by both Belgian and EU laws, focusing on emissions control, waste management, and the protection of natural habitats.
What are the potential legal risks in the oil, gas, and energy sector?
Legal risks can include non-compliance with environmental laws, contractual disputes, allegations of anti-competitive practices, and negligence claims regarding health and safety standards.
How does the legal framework support renewable energy initiatives?
The legal framework in Belgium encourages renewable energy through laws that provide incentives, such as tax credits, grants, and favorable tariffs for renewable energy producers.
Can foreign companies invest in the Antwerp energy sector?
Yes, foreign companies can invest in Antwerp's energy sector, but they must comply with Belgian and EU investment regulations and obtain the necessary approvals and permits.
How are disputes in the energy sector typically resolved?
Disputes can be resolved through negotiation, mediation, arbitration, or litigation, depending on the nature of the conflict and the parties' preferences.
What role does the European Union play in energy regulation in Antwerp?
The EU plays a significant role by setting overarching legal standards and regulations that Member States, including Belgium, must adhere to, particularly regarding market competition and environmental policies.
Are there specific employment laws for workers in the energy sector?
While general Belgian employment laws apply, there are additional health and safety regulations specifically targeted at protecting workers in the hazardous environments typical of the energy sector.
What taxation laws affect the oil and gas industry?
Special tax regimes apply to the oil and gas sector, including taxes on production and exploration activities, which are subject to both national laws and EU regulations.
Is it possible to develop offshore energy projects from Antwerp?
Yes, Belgium supports offshore energy development, particularly wind energy, requiring specific permits and adherence to maritime laws and environmental protection standards.
Additional Resources
For individuals seeking further information, several resources and organizations can be helpful:
- FPS Economy, SMEs, Self-employed and Energy: The Federal Public Service provides information on energy policies and regulations.
- Vlaamse Reguleringsinstantie voor de Elektriciteits- en Gasmarkt (VREG): The Flemish regulator for the electricity and gas markets is responsible for market oversight in the region.
- Port of Antwerp: As a major energy hub, the Port of Antwerp offers resources and contacts for companies in the oil and gas industries.
- Belgian Petroleum Federation: Represents companies active in refining, marketing, and distribution of petroleum products in Belgium.
- Belgian Renewable Energy Association: Offers resources and advocacy for renewable energy initiatives.
